Rebecca Phyllis Oliver (Newman) Obituary

It is with selfish hearts we share that Rebecca Phyllis Oliver (Newman), 83, passed away peacefully on Monday, December 1, 2025. 


Becky was born at home in Hawesville, KY on February 27, 1942 to the late Homer Otto Newman and Eugenia Loretta Newman(Dunn). She graduated from Hawesville High School in 1960. She met the love of her life, Otis Guy Oliver, Jr, at a bus stop, thanks to late buses for both of them. It was pretty much love at first sight.She was an active member of the Baptist church in Hawesville, and he was a student pastor at the little Presbyterian church across the road. They married that summer after her graduation and she proudly became a minister’s wife. 


She was a devoted minister’s wife and mother, serving the Lord with gladness. She never had idle hands, cooking for her family and church family, a skilled seamstress, avid crafter, and devourer of books, especially her Bible. She was blessed with a beautiful voice and loved singing in the choir and with her husband. She was the epitome of the Proverbs 31 woman. She was actively involved in her children’s school days and after a time decided it was time for her to return to school. She received her BSRN from Hinds Junior College in Raymond, MS. She worked as an RN with newborn babies until her grandchildren arrived and she stepped away from her career to be a devoted grandmother.
